Early Life and Background
Born on February 12, 1917, Odessa Grady Clay entered the world in Hopkins County, Kentucky. Living in a large family with six siblings, Odessa’s early life was filled with close bonds and the hustle and bustle common to big families. Challenges and Perseverance
Now, let’s talk about grit and determination. You’ve probably noticed that it takes a certain kind of toughness to overcome significant barriers, right? Odessa was a household domestic and cook in Louisville during the harsh realities of segregation. Not only was she working long hours, but she was also nurturing a family at home.
Her faith, though, was her true north. Being a devout Baptist, Odessa anchored her life on deep-rooted values and dignity, teaching herself and her kids to stay strong when the world outside looked bleak. She was the quiet storm, setting a tremendous example of strength and dignity.

Role in Muhammad Ali’s Early Life
Ah, the twist of fate! Imagine a young Muhammad Ali, his bike stolen, ready to pound down doors and demand justice. Enter Odessa, urging him to channel that fire constructively. She nudged him to report the theft, which led to his introduction to boxing. Can you see it? The world almost missed out on Ali’s brilliance if not for a heartbreak over a bicycle and a mother’s gentle wisdom. That small nudge, that moment of encouragement, forever altered the trajectory of the sports world.
